JR Central: Off to Nara, the ‘Asuka’ editionRyohei Suzuki

“Iza Iza Nara” Asuka Edition – 60 seconds

In the JR Central travel campaign commercial “Iza Iza Nara,” this installment highlights the charms of Asuka Village.

It opens with scenes of the Ishibutai Kofun and the Masuda Iwafune, then Ryohei Suzuki goes on to visit one famous spot after another around Asuka Village.

It ends with a shot of him enjoying delicious-looking dishes at the traditional house restaurant Da terra, leaving a strong impression of someone fully savoring all that Asuka Village has to offer.

JR Central (Central Japan Railway Company) ‘Yes, let’s go to Kyoto.’ 2019 Spring — Spring is dawn / Sunrise version — 30 seconds

[TVCM] Spring 2019 “Spring begins at dawn: Sunrise Edition” That’s it—let’s go to Kyoto.

“My Favorite Things,” a song from the musical The Sound of Music, is not only featured in the show but also known as a jazz standard.

In this JR Central “Yes, let’s go to Kyoto” commercial, you can enjoy an arrangement by Tokyo Shiokouji.

It perfectly captures the atmosphere of a Kyoto morning.

JR Central ‘X’mas Express’

Nice commercial: JR Tokai (Central Japan Railway) Christmas Express, Riho Makise

This is a now-legendary commercial overflowing with the charm of Riho Makise, who was 17 at the time.

I think it was around this period that drama-style commercials started becoming more common.

This ad is part of JR Central’s Tokaido Shinkansen series that ran from 1989 to 1992, and later featured Rina Takahashi and Takami Yoshimoto, gaining great popularity.

Above all, Tatsuro Yamashita’s “Christmas Eve” was an incredibly effective BGM—just hearing the song brings this commercial to mind for many people.

The phrase “XX Express” also became a standard expression thanks to this CM.
